Informational technical overview describing the development, components, treatment processes, environmental functions, and operational characteristics of the Arcata Wastewater Treatment Facility and its integrated natural wetland system.
Population: ~17,700
Design Flow: 2.3 MGD
Initial System: Oxidation ponds
Year of Initial System: 1952
Upgrade with Wetlands: 1985
Average Annual Removal: 1 million lbs BOD; 1 million lbs TSS; 80 thousand lbs Ammonia
Total Footprint of Natural System: 90 acres
Ponds Area: 46 acres
Treatment Wetlands Area: 12 acres
Enhancement Wetlands Area: 32 acres
Receiving Water Body: Humboldt Bay
Facility Name: Arcata Wastewater Treatment Facility (AWTF)
Associated Site: Arcata Marsh and Wildlife Sanctuary
Treatment Components: Headworks, Bar Screens, Grit Chamber, Clarifier, Oxidation Ponds, Treatment Wetlands, Enhancement Wetlands, Anaerobic Digesters, Drying Beds
Disinfection Method: Chlorine gas (planned transition to UV disinfection)
Byproduct: Class A Biosolids used in city parks
Permit Beneficial Uses: Wetland habitat, wetland research, environmental education
